AI is changing almost every aspect of our lives, but did you know it’s also affecting the way cyber attacks could be carried out?

Researchers at the University of Toronto recently demonstrated a proof-of-concept AI-powered computer worm that could identify weaknesses, adapt its approach, and spread across a test network. It did this without human guidance, and over seven days it compromised nearly three-quarters of the network it was targeting.

The worm wasn't relying on any futuristic AI magic either, instead It was taking advantage of familiar problems that people and organisations have been dealing with for years: outdated software, weak passwords and misconfigurations on the back end.

A computer worm is a type of malicious software that spreads from one device to another by exploiting specific security weaknesses. This new AI-driven wriggly menace was able to adapt itself and look for different weaknesses as it moved through the test network.

The thought of a self-evolving worm might sound terrifying, but the research highlights once again why we in the Cybersecurity team keep repeating the same key messages.

The basics still work

  • One of the most effective things you can do is keep your software updated. Attackers love searching for any outdated software or devices that may have security weaknesses they can take advantage of. The longer you delay an update, the more time it gives cyber criminals to find a way to exploit it.
  • Strong, unique passwords are just as important. Reusing passwords means that if one account is compromised, others may be at risk too. Keep it complex, keep it unique, and where available, enable multifactor authentication (MFA) for an additional layer of protection.

While there’s plenty cybersecurity teams can do behind the scenes to keep things safe and locked down, software updates, strong passwords and MFA remain some of the simplest and most effective ways we can all do our part.

As AI continues to evolve and new threats emerge, it's easy to assume we need completely new solutions. But research like this is a reminder that good cybersecurity habits are still some of our strongest defences. As Professor Nicolas Papernot from the University of Toronto puts it:

"We can all do our part by removing as many digital vulnerabilities as possible. To start, no more delaying software updates, no more reusing easy passwords, and we need to use multifactor authentication as much as possible."
